Understanding the Gameplay Mechanics
At its core, the chicken road game relies on incredibly simple mechanics. Players control a chicken attempting to cross a road filled with oncoming traffic. Success depends on tapping the screen at the precise moment to move the chicken forward, navigating between gaps in the vehicles. The speed of the traffic often increases as the game progresses, escalating the difficulty. The game rewards players with points for successfully crossing sections of the road. The straightforward premise belie a surprisingly high skill ceiling, and mastering the timing required for safe passage separates casual players from devoted enthusiasts.
Different variations of the game introduce additional elements, such as power-ups that grant temporary invincibility or slow down time. These additions add layers of strategy and excitement. The art style also plays a significant role in the experience, ranging from pixelated retro designs to fully 3D environments. Sound design further enhances immersion, with realistic traffic noises and cheerful sound effects accompanying successful crossings. Understanding these elements is essential to grasp the game’s addictive quality.
Here’s a breakdown of common gameplay features:
- Traffic Patterns: The vehicles move at varying speeds and follow unpredictable paths.
- Power-Ups: Collectible items offer temporary advantages.
- Scoring System: Points are awarded for distance traveled and successful crossings.
- Difficulty Progression: The game gradually becomes more challenging.
The Psychology Behind the Addiction
The enduring appeal of the chicken road game isn’t purely based on its simple mechanics; its psychological hooks are equally significant. The game provides immediate feedback – a successful crossing is instantly rewarding, while a collision results in immediate failure. This constant cycle of reward and punishment reinforces the desire to play again, encouraging players to refine their timing and strategy. The intermittent reinforcement schedule – where rewards aren’t guaranteed every time – is particularly effective at driving engagement as it keeps players consistently motivated.
Furthermore, the game taps into our innate desire for mastery and control. Players feel a sense of accomplishment when they successfully navigate increasingly difficult obstacles. The relatively short game sessions also contribute to its addictive nature, making it easy to fit a few quick rounds into downtime. The game provides a distraction from real-world stressors and offers a sense of flow, where players become fully immersed in the present moment. Psychological factors combined with carefully crafted gameplay mechanics make it a captivating and often obsessive experience.
The following elements contribute to the game’s addictive nature:
- Immediate Feedback: Instant reward or punishment.
- Intermittent Reinforcement: Unpredictable rewards keep players engaged.
- Sense of Mastery: Progressively increasing difficulty provides a challenge.
- Flow State: Immersion in the moment.
